Men’s Basketball: Oles pull away from Scots

Box Score
St. Olaf shot 54% for the game, making 9-of-20 from behind the three-point arc, and went on to gain a 96-57 win over the Scots at Macalester's Leonard Center.  The Oles advance to 9-4 on the season and 6-2 in the MIAC, while the Scots drop to 2-12 overall, 1-8 in MIAC play.  St. Olaf out-scored the home team 19-9 from the free throw stripe and enjoyed a 27-7 turnover advantage to net 40 points off turnovers.

Macalester had a couple starters reach double figures in scoring.  Dylan Kilgour (So., La Crescenta, Calif. / Crescenta Valley) led the way with 15 points to go along with four assists.  Kareem Ismail (Fy., Pasadena, Calif. / Flintridge Prep) added 14 points, and with nine re bounds, just missed out on a double-double.

Sager Moritzky (Fy., San Juan Capistrano, Calif. / St. Margaret's Episcopal) dished out eight assists.

Charlie Aslesen led the way for St. Olaf with 23 points.  Justin Pahl added 15 points and Josh Pratt scored 13.

Macalester returns to action next Monday (Jan. 13) against Carleton at the Leonard Center at 7:45 pm.
